Quite varied: There are many options of how you practice. Some do basic science and translational research, in addition to seeing patients. Some do more hematology, others, only oncology and many do both. Some work primarily in a clinic, others take care of hospitalized patients, many do both. In academic settings, we teach residents and fellows. Some are involved with clinic trial design.
